The Séance of Blake Manor Review

The Séance of Blake Manor is an atmospheric detective adventure set in a late 19th-century Irish mansion, richly infused with Irish folklore, mythology, and history. Players investigate the mysterious disappearance of Evelyn Deane by interacting with a large cast of characters, exploring the manor, and solving interconnected mysteries. The game features a unique time mechanic where every action consumes time, encouraging strategic prioritization. While it offers a compelling narrative and immersive setting, the gameplay is more linear than some expect, with heavy handholding and automated deduction limiting player agency. The puzzles are generally straightforward, serving more as narrative devices than challenging obstacles. Technical issues such as bugs, long loading times between rooms, and occasional narrative inconsistencies somewhat detract from the experience. Despite these flaws, many players found the game engaging, with a strong story, memorable characters, and a fresh take on the detective genre that rewards exploration and investigation.

Highlights

Players praise the game's rich atmosphere and authentic Irish setting, which creates a captivating and spooky vibe. The time-based action system is highlighted as a novel mechanic that adds strategic depth without feeling punishing. The large, diverse cast of characters and their individual storylines provide engaging content and emotional investment. The intuitive UI and detective mind map help track clues and leads effectively. Additionally, the voice acting and art style are frequently commended for enhancing immersion, and the overall narrative is appreciated for its twists and cultural depth.

Criticisms

Common criticisms include the game's linear and handholding gameplay, which limits player deduction and makes the investigation feel guided rather than earned. Many players note the puzzles are too simple and sometimes feel disconnected from the detective work. Technical issues such as long loading times between rooms, occasional bugs that can block progress, and clunky UI navigation reduce enjoyment. Some narrative elements suffer from dialogue inconsistencies and poor timing references, breaking immersion. The time mechanic, while innovative, often feels superficial since players have ample time to complete objectives, diminishing tension. Lastly, the final resolution is seen as underwhelming and unearned by some, undermining prior deductions.
